1. The Museum of Fine Arts

Being one of the United States’ largest museums, the iconic place hosts more than 6000 years of rich history. Spanning six continents, the permanent collection here boasts of more than 70000 articles. There are nine facilities wherein these articles are housed. Historically, the Museum of Fine Arts, Houston (MFAH) continues to be the largest museum in Texas. Founded over a hundred years ago, the MFAH is also the largest cultural institution in the area. Setting apart the facilities wherein the exhibitions reside, there is also a cinema, two libraries, an archive and a conservation and storage facility. 

Among its outstanding collection of seventy thousand, the museum has everything from every place. Be it the cool West or the chaotic Middle East, from the era of the Impressionists to today’s contemporary art style, the MFAH has it all. Dive into the wonderful collection of the museum. Not only does it house American Painting and Sculpture, Islamic Art, Antiquities that transcend space and time, but also does it feature breathtaking artworks from Asia, Africa, and Europe.
